The fundamental technology behind these protective devices is both elegant and scientifically grounded. RFID blocking cards do not actively "jam" signals; rather, they create a Faraday cage around your sensitive cards. This cage is typically constructed from materials like aluminum, copper, or a proprietary metallic mesh that absorbs and disperses electromagnetic fields, preventing scanners from reading the chips inside your wallet. This hands-on demonstration was far more convincing than any marketing claim. From a technical specification perspective, it's critical to understand the parameters. Effective blocking cards must shield against the common frequency bands used by personal devices: 125-134 kHz (Low Frequency, used for some access cards), 13.56 MHz (High Frequency, used for NFC and most contactless credit cards/passports), and 860-960 MHz (Ultra-High Frequency, used for inventory tracking). A card like the TIANJUN ShieldPro, for instance, claims a shielding effectiveness of >60 dB across the 13.56 MHz band, with a composite material layer thickness of 0.3mm. The card itself typically conforms to the ID-1 ISO/IEC 7810 standard size of 85.60 × 53.98 mm, ensuring it fits seamlessly in any wallet slot. When formulating a personal RFID blocking card product opinion, it is essential to balance the promise of security with realistic expectations. No product is 100% infallible, and determined criminals may employ other tactics like phishing or physical theft. Therefore, a blocking card should be viewed as one component of a broader defensive posture that includes monitoring bank statements, using strong passwords, and being aware of one's surroundings. The market offers a wide range, from simple foil-lined sleeves to sophisticated multi-layered cards with additional features like integrated bottle openers or membership slots.
